Trendline R square
Hi every body, Can you please help me with this confusing issue? My data is preseted in a scatter plot and the trendline is shown in the figure. The R square value from the trendline option is not the same as the one I got from the Data analysis option from the tools menu (This is an Add-in option). To be sepecific the trend line gave an R square= 0.5465 where the data analysis gave an R square=0.9804509. Trendline R square
Please provide more information:
- version of Excel - how the model is specified for the ATP regression tool - for the ATP regression, are you looking at "Multiple R", "R Square", or "Adjusted R Square"? - what chart type did you use "Line" or "XY (Scatter)"? - what type of trend line on the chart? If the data is not too extensive or too sensitive, it might help to list it in the body of your reply (no attachments, please).
